all i really want is the bolstering on the bullitt / GT500 seats  while keeping my dove / charcoal leather configuration

so, i went to the ford dealer to ask about pricing. turns out that mustang seats ae not all one piesce, so thats good: all i need are the seatback cusions and covers should run me about $1000 for the driver and passenger together

then i would have to take both covers to an upholstery place and have them switch out the middle sections (if that can even be done) for i dunno how much, because bullitt seat covers are all black

anyway, this way i wont have to deal with heated seats and all the hassle of uninstalling / reinstalling them and it should tun out something like this




let me know what you think

Just go to an interior shop and tell them what you want to have done.  $1k seems like an outrageous price for just seat back covers and cushions.  An interior shop should be able to do exactly whatever you want done and for much less money.  When I had my truck, I was going to have the front seats completely redone in two-tone suede with new bolstering and it was only going to cost me around $500.

What parts?  You said all you needed were the seat back covers and cushions.  You don't need Ford parts to take care of those, and good interior shop should be able to take care of it.  I live out in the country but we still have a good interior shop here that can do pretty much anything you want with an interior.  They can get any type of seat cover you want along with the padding, then stitch it up in any pattern however you want it.  Just go ask an interior shop to make it look like you are wanting to, and I bet they can help you out and do it way cheaper than you are planning right now.
